SiTF’s
eGovernment Chapter
- Formed
in April 2005
- To
promote the interests of local ICT-member
companies in
overseas by leveraging
on iDA’s credentials in eGovernment.
- To
promote jointly with iDA, the capabilities
and solutions of local
ICT enterprise
(iLEs) members to foreign governments.
- To
manage the process for SiTF eGov
Chapter members collaborating
with
iDA in the pursuit of eGovernment
business opportunities overseas
- To
provide a forum for the learning
and sharing of eGovernment experiences,
and collaboration amongst members
SiTF
eGovernment Chapter – Benefits
- Access
to e-Government opportunities
- Facilitate
collaboration with fellow member
companies on foreign e-Government
opportunities
- Learning
and sharing of e-Government technologies
and
best practices
Local
Enterprise Association Development
(LEAD)
In
July 2006, IE Singapore and SPRING
approved the LEAD application to fund
the development effort for exporting
our e-government solutions. With this
foundation the eGovernment Chapter
is well poised for a more active and
aggressive programme to grow the e-government
market for the Singapore infocomm industry,
in particular, for SiTF members.
